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is a crucial aspect of any website's success. It helps search engines understand the content on your site and rank it appropriately for relevant keywords. SEO has three major types: technical, on-page, and off-page.


Technical SEO is all about optimizing your website's structure and other behind-the-scenes elements to make it more search engine friendly. It's important to understand how search engines see your website and identify any issues that may be preventing them from crawling, indexing, and ranking your content.


One of the best ways to optimize your site for technical SEO is by using a technical SEO checklist. This checklist will help you identify and resolve any issues that may be hindering your site's visibility and performance in search engine rankings.


The checklist includes tasks such as optimizing your website's structure, making sure your site is mobile-friendly, and ensuring that your site loads quickly. It also includes tasks that have an indirect relationship with technical SEO, such as ensuring that your site is secure and has a valid SSL certificate.


It's important to note that while on-page SEO focuses on optimizing the content on your site, technical SEO is all about making sure the site itself is optimized for search engines.
